Make example for this keyboard (after setting up your build environment):

make wuque/promise87/ansi:default

Flashing example for this keyboard:

make wuque/promise87/ansi:default:flash

Bootloader

Enter the bootloader using one of the following methods:

  • Tap the Reset switch mounted on the PCB
  • In the case of the default keymap, use the key combination Fn + PageUp
  • Hold the Esc key while connecting the USB cable (also erases persistent settings)
